Eddie Roach was born February 6, 1944, in Tensas Parish to proud parents James Roach and Leila Roach.
Eddie received his education from the Madison Parish School System where he graduated with the class of 1963. Upon graduating high school, Eddie enlisted into the United States Army to protect our country. He served until he was honorably discharged.
He furthered his career path by working for the Madison Parish School Board as a bus mechanic and bus driver for 27 years.
He was preceded in death by his parents and his brother, Henry Caldwell.
Eddie leaves to cherish his memories: two sons, Eddie Gaines (Vickie) and Jackie Roach (Lora); one daughter, Ursula Roach; six brothers, Lee Earl Berry, Robert Roach, Arthur Roach, Alfred Roach, Alton Roach (Andrea), and Wesley Roach (Patricia); two sisters, Caroletta Roach and Rosie Roach; sister-in-law, Ann Caldwell; eleven grandchildren; and a host of great-grandchildren, extended family, and friends.
